Medical Coding & Billing:  "The Basics"

*4 AAPC CEUs

How much do you really know about coding and billing?

This 4 hour seminar will help attendees learn and understand how coding, billing and reimbursement work. The many uses and applications of medical coding will also be explored. 

Recommended for novice coder/billers, nurses, medical office staff, healthcare providers and other professionals who service medical practices such as insurance brokers, collection agencies, accountants, consultants as well as any individual seriously considering a career change to medical coding and billing.

We will cover:

  • Overview of Medical Coding; Diagnoses and Procedure Codes
  • Rationale of medical necessity
  • Walk through the Reimbursement Process: From building the CMS-1500 to health insurance filing and collections.

Evaluation & Management: Intro

*4 AAPC CEUs

Finally, learn how to code E & M services utilizing the proper coding criteria.  Eliminate the "guessing game".

You will learn how to interpret the guidelines and determine code selection based on place of service, type of service and patient status.

We will cover:

Full scope of E&M section (99201-99499). With focus on following:

  • Office/Outpatient Services (99201-99215)
  • Inpatient Services (99221-99233)

The seven (7) components of E&M codes will be discussed:  history, exam, medical decision-making, counseling, coordination of care, nature of presenting problem and time

Evaluation & Management:  Auditing

*4 AAPC CEUs

Auditing is an integral piece of compliance but many fear the mere mention of it.  It is necessary and is here to stay. The seemingly "overwhelming challenge" of auditing will be broken down to manageable pieces.

We will cover:

  • The Medical Record and its components
  • 1995 vs 1997 E&M Documentation Guidelines
  • Sample E&M Audit Exercises
  • Types and purposes of Audits
  • The Baseline Audit: Who, How and When
